## Further reading

Glimmerstat is the metrics-aggregation sidecar that runs beside every Harkfield service pod. It batches counters locally, flushes every ten seconds, and drops cardinality above the configured cap. New team members should skim the flush pipeline overview and the tagging conventions before adding metrics. Architecture notes, config reference, and the cardinality policy are collected on the internal page below.

dashboard of kajep-tajog = https://harbor.tolvaqworks.example/pipeline/run/dash/pipeline/228e278bbf9b3bc2

## Service Accounts: Image Slimming Pipeline

The Thornquist slimming service strips unused layers from container images before they reach the Pellardine registry. It runs under a dedicated service account with read-only registry scope; reviewers should verify no write grants slip in. The account authenticates to the internal Pellardine API at startup. The key used by that service account is recorded below.

gateway credential: kto7_GoY89Me

# Break-Glass Access — Reset Flow Revamp

For the weekly sync: the Lockstone password reset revamp ships behind a flag. If the flag service or the reset queue stalls, use break-glass to bypass the new flow and restore legacy resets. Break-glass requires two approvers on record and auto-expires in 60 minutes. Log every use in the incident channel. Access to the break-glass console is gated by the passphrase that follows.

unlock words, yagaf-yagep: ulaox-silath-julael-aldix-kasath-jorath-ulays-druael-eliir-sorvan-silion-kasok-fraok

Subject: PortionWise cut-over complete

Hi all — the recipe-scaling calculator moved off the legacy MeasureMate backend to our new PortionWise service on Tuesday. Unit conversions, fractional rounding, and batch scaling now run through one engine; the old endpoints return 410. Scaling history migrated cleanly, aside from a few pre-2019 drafts we archived. New team members should note the service boots with the configuration below.

service settings:
WENATH_PIN=5007
WENATH_METRICS_HOST=metrics.wenath.tolvaqlabs.corp
WENATH_LOG_LEVEL=debug
WENATH_TENANT=rusox